### Step 4: Export worker memory cap

The GridLedger export worker previously buffered entire spreadsheets in memory. After migration, exports stream row-by-row with a hard 256 MB cap per job. Verify the cap in `export.limits`. Jobs exceeding it abort and log to the audit channel. No user data persists on the worker after completion. Review retention flags on the staging store before sign-off. The worker authenticates to the export metadata database with the connection string below.

replica DSN, kajep-yahag: mssql://praok_svc:iF@db-8d68.plorvaio.local:5432/eliion

# Break-Glass: Catalog Cache Invalidation

Scope: the Pinrow product catalog at Veldstone Retail. If stale prices persist after a purge and the Hollowmere invalidation queue is wedged, use break-glass to flush the edge tier directly. Contractors: get verbal sign-off from the catalog lead first. Steps: open the Hollowmere admin shell, select emergency-flush, confirm the tenant, and run it once — repeated flushes thrash the origin. Access is logged and expires after 20 minutes. Unseal the admin shell with the passphrase below.

recovery phrase for kahop-tajog: istix-casvan

Ticket #4471 — Heads up: the service credential for TimeGrid, our school timetable solver, expired overnight and the nightly schedule runs are failing. The cron box at Drellview campus keeps retrying with the stale token, so you'll see a burst of 401s in the audit log — that's us, not an attacker. We've minted a replacement with the same scopes, valid 90 days. For your review, the new key for the solver backend is below.

API key for tagug-tajef: vxb4-R1fo